Curriculum Breadth and Depth

Enniskillen Collegiate's curriculum is designed to offer students a broad and balanced education, encompassing a wide range of subjects across the humanities, sciences, and arts. While upholding traditional academic disciplines, the school also proactively introduces innovative programs designed to prepare students for the demands of a rapidly changing world. Emphasis is placed on interdisciplinary learning, encouraging students to connect concepts from different subject areas and apply their knowledge to real-world challenges. Furthermore, a commitment to developing digital literacy skills ensures that students are proficient in using technology to enhance their learning experience and prepare for future careers. The school recognizes the importance of providing opportunities for students to explore their individual passions and talents.

Key StageTypical Subjects Offered
GCSEEnglish Language, English Literature, Mathematics, Science (Biology, Chemistry, Physics), History, Geography, Modern Languages, Art, Music, Technology, Physical Education
A-LevelMathematics, Further Mathematics, Biology, Chemistry, Physics, English Literature, History, Government and Politics, Art, Music, Technology

Beyond the core curriculum, Enniskillen Collegiate provides enrichment opportunities through clubs, societies, and workshops, fostering a holistic approach to education. This broad offering reflects the school's dedication to nurturing a diverse range of talents and interests.
